Must-Have Plugins List

When building a WordPress website, choosing the right plugins can make all the difference in functionality and performance.

Here's a must-have plugins list to enhance your site:

  1. Yoast SEO: Optimize your content for search engines with tools for managing meta tags and readability scores.
  2. WooCommerce: Perfect for e-commerce, it allows you to sell products and services with ease, offering inventory management and payment gateways.
  3. Contact Form 7: Create and manage multiple customizable contact forms with spam protection to boost user interaction.
  4. W3 Total Cache: Improve your website's speed and SEO performance through caching, leading to faster loading times.

You'll find that these plugins greatly elevate your WordPress development experience.

Don't forget to also check out Smush for image optimization!

Caching Techniques Explained

Caching techniques are essential for enhancing your WordPress website's speed and performance, as they store static versions of your web pages.

By implementing these methods, you can achieve significant performance enhancements and drastically reduce load times for your visitors.

Here are four effective caching techniques to evaluate:

  1. Browser Caching: Allows users' browsers to store files locally, speeding up their next visit.
  2. Server-Side Caching: Optimizes PHP execution times for faster dynamic content delivery.
  3. Caching Plugins: Tools like W3 Total Cache or WP Super Cache can reduce load times by up to 80%.
  4. Content Delivery Networks (CDNs): Distribute cached content globally, ensuring rapid access for users everywhere.

Adopting these strategies will elevate your website's performance and user experience.

Image Compression Tools

Images play an essential role in your website's design, but large file sizes can slow down loading times and hurt user experience.

To tackle this, use image compression tools like Smush or ShortPixel, which can reduce file sizes by up to 80% without sacrificing quality. Google recommends keeping images under 100 KB to optimize images effectively.

A faster website enhances loading speeds, which is significant since a mere 1-second delay can lead to a 7% drop in conversions. Additionally, consider using a Content Delivery Network (CDN) alongside compression to further boost site performance.

Regularly monitoring and compressing images will improve user engagement and reduce bounce rates, essential for both SEO and a positive user experience.

Backup and Security Measures

Keeping your WordPress site updated is just the beginning of maintaining a secure and reliable online presence. You must implement robust backup solutions, like UpdraftPlus, to protect your website data from crashes or hacks.

Regularly updating the WordPress core, themes, and plugins helps shield against security vulnerabilities that could compromise your site.

Additionally, using security monitoring tools such as Wordfence offers real-time protection against threats, enhancing your overall website security.

Don't forget routine maintenance; cleaning up unnecessary data with plugins like WP-Sweep can improve website performance and minimize risks linked to outdated content.

Establishing a consistent maintenance schedule guarantees your site remains functional and secure, providing a better experience for your visitors.

Cost-Effectiveness of WordPress Solutions

wordpress solutions cost analysis

When considering a website for your business, WordPress stands out as a cost-effective solution that won't break the bank. You can build a basic WordPress site for as little as $100 to $300 by utilizing low-cost themes and plugins.

Even if you need something more advanced, the cost can range from $1,000 to $10,000, depending on your specific needs. WordPress offers scalability, allowing your site to grow alongside your business without hefty additional investments.

The availability of numerous affordable solutions and community support keeps development costs down while maintaining quality. This means you can enhance your site without worrying about ongoing expenses, making WordPress a smart choice for your budget-conscious business.
